Grant Eadie, aka Manatee Commune, is a musician based in the Pacific Northwest. His music combines field recordings, textures from nature, surfy guitar licks, arpeggiated sine waves, and classically influenced viola. In our conversation, Grant and I talk about his early musical memories and the episode of MTV Cribs that started his fascination with electronic music.
